New issue 247 by [email protected]: Ascending seconds-to-octaves test intervals  
are beyond Bass range
http://code.google.com/p/solfege/issues/detail?id=247


> What steps will reproduce the problem?

1. File->Front page
2. Select Ascending music intervals
3. Config Input Interface to be Bass
4. File->Test page
5. Select Ascending music intervals
6. Seconds to Octaves

> What is the expected output? What do you see instead?

In the test mode the intervals are given higher pitched than
the extent of the Bass. I can hear them, but they can not be drawn.

The higher pitch seems to be always beyond the range.
The lowest is sometimes within the range.

Note, in the practive mode all the intervals are within the Bass range.


> What version of the product are you using? On what operating system?

Solfedge 3.20.3 compiled from tarball.
Also present in Solfege 3.16.4 whish is part of the OS distribution
which is Linux 2.6.32-5-686 i686, Debian 6.0.2 which is stable.
